Obama Fiddles as Social Security Goes Bankrupt

Budget submitted by President will see SS in red for first time ever, by $2.6 billion in ten years.

(Alexandria, Virginia) – The fiscal 2013 budget President Obama submitted to Congress yesterday adds another dubious distinction to its historic record of debt; a projection of Social Security going into the red for the first time in the program’s history.  According to Obama’s budget blueprint, the Social Security trust fund will be depleted in 2022, and show $2.6 billion in debt, prompting a statement from 60 Plus Association Chairman Jim Martin, leader of the largest national conservative seniors advocacy organization:

“The President is working overtime to bankrupt America, and he’s getting practice by bankrupting Social Security as a warm-up,” said Martin. “For the first time in our history, the Social Security trust fund is literally going to be a ‘bust fund,’ with zero assets in reserve, which will leave future retirees with benefits slashed to the bone.”
